How Our Basement Water Damage Restoration Process Works
With basement water damage, a proper process is crucial to preventing further damage and ensuring a thorough restoration. Our team will work with you every step of the way to ensure that your home is safe and secure. We’ll start by assessing the damage, then move on to the extraction and drying process, and finally, we’ll work on restoring your basement to its original condition.
Assessment and Planning
We’ll conduct a thorough assessment of your basement to identify the source of the water damage and find out the best course of action. Our technicians will use specialized equipment to detect hidden water sources and develop a customized plan to tackle the issue.
Extraction and Drying
Once we’ve identified the source of the water damage, our team will use specialized equipment to extract the water and dry your basement. This process typically takes 3-5 days, depending on the severity of the damage.
Restoration and Repair
After the extraction and drying process is complete, our team will work on restoring your basement to its original condition. This may involve repairing or replacing damaged drywall, flooring, and other materials.
Final Inspection and Cleanup
Once the restoration process is complete, our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ure that your basement is safe and secure. We’ll also take care of any necessary cleanup and disposal of damaged materials.

Warning Signs You Need Basement Water Damage Restoration
Ignoring the signs of basement water damage can lead to costly repairs and even health hazards. Here are some common warning signs to look out for: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, musty odors in your basement can be a sign of hidden water damage. Don’t ignore it, our team can help you identify the source and fix the issue before it’s too late.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age. Our team can assess the damage and provide a customized solution to get your flooring back to normal.
Water Stains or Discoloration
Water stains or discoloration on your walls or ceiling can be a sign of water damage. Our team can help you identify the source and provide a solution to prevent further damage.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age. Our team can assess the damage and provide a solution to get your walls back to normal.
Visible Signs of Water Damage
Visible signs of water damage, such as standing water or mineral deposits, can be a sign of a larger issue. Our team can help you identify the source and provide a solution to prevent further damage.

Basement Water Damage Restoration Cost in Kiefer, OK
The cost of basement water damage restoration can vary widely dep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Kiefer, OK. These estimates are based on our experience and may not reflect your specific situation.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Extraction and Dr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ed. |
| Restoration and Repair | $1,000 – $5,000 | Materials needed, labor costs, and complexity of the job. |
| Final Inspection and Cleanup |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, complexity of the job, and equipment needed. |
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ment and free estimates are available upon request.
